zookeeper
⑨笙清栀
海到无边天作岸
展开
-
zookeeper学习(一)
一、ZooKeeper简介ZooKeeper:动物管理员Apache ZooKeeper致力于开发和维护开源服务器,实现高度可靠的分布式协调。什么是ZooKeeper?ZooKeeper是一种集中式服务,用于维护配置信息,命名,提供分布式同步和提供组服务。所有这 些类型的服务都以分布式应用程序的某种形式使用。每次实施它们都需要做很多工作来修复不可避 免的错误和竞争条件。由于难以实现...原创 2019-02-24 13:36:35 · 155 阅读 · 0 评论 -
zookeeper集群中服务器的角色和状态
zk服务:不同角色执行不同的任务。在区分zk服务器角色前,先解释几个概念:1.事务请求:在zk中,那些会改变服务器状态的请求称为事务请求(创建节点、更新数据、删除节点、创建会话等等)2.非事务请求从zk读取数据但是不对状态进行任何修改的请求称为非事务请求Leader角色Leader服务器是zk集群工作的核心,其主要工作有两个:事务请求的唯一调度者和处理者,保证集群事务处理的顺序性...原创 2019-02-24 13:56:59 · 652 阅读 · 0 评论 -
zookeeper的选举机制
http://www.cnblogs.com/leesf456/p/6107600.html一、前言 前面学习了Zookeeper服务端的相关细节,其中对于集群启动而言,很重要的一部分就是Leader选举,接着就开始深入学习Leader选举。二、Leader选举 2.1 Leader选举概述 Leader选举是保证分布式数据一致性的关键所在。当Zookeeper集群中的一台服务器出...转载 2019-02-24 14:49:52 · 185 阅读 · 0 评论